The LLG Labware Precision-Laboratory Thermometer, -100 to +30°C, Enclosed Scale, Capillary Transparent, Prismatic, L:305 mm, Suitable For Calibration is designed for measuring low temperatures from -100 to +30 °C. It features an enclosed scale according to DIN 12778, transparent prismatic capillary, and total immersion depth for practical laboratory temperature measurement.
